I received my letter of eligibility several months ago, and have since obtained an advanced degree. May I submit verification of my advanced degree and ask to amend my score?
No. Your newly acquired education or experience cannot be considered after your name has been placed into the pool of eligibles. However, if the recruitment is still open, you may re-apply and submit any additional education and experience on your new application. It may or may not affect your score.
